What are the highlights of the iPad Air 5?
Apple M1 chip
The M1 chip used in iPad Air 5 is based on the same chip as iPad Pro (2021), which features an 8-core CPU, up to 60% faster than the previous generation, up to 2 faster 8-core graphics. This allows for seamless switching between apps. work on graphics Faster photo editing or video editing there is also a 16‑core Neural Engine to help the system run faster as well.

The latest iPad Air 5 comes with 8GB of RAM, which is a RAM upgrade from the 4GB-based iPad Air 4. And partly because Apple has inserted an M1 chip into the iPad Air 5 to help it perform better.
Front camera upgrade
The latest iPad Air 5 (2022) has an upgraded front-facing camera with an Ultra-Wide 12MP lens and a Center Stage feature that helps people stay in the center of the frame. because the camera will automatically follow the person When people enter and exit the frame The image will be enlarged or zoomed in by itself. It can be said that it meets the needs of using video calls, presenting work, or shooting videos with the front camera, it will help solve the problem of frame drop very well.
Liquid Retina 10.9” screen
iPad Air 5 comes with the original design, full edge screen, no home button, which is a Liquid Retina 10.9″ screen, helping to display the screen sharp with a brightness of up to 500 nits, True Tone display when needed The screen for a long time will help to be more comfortable on the eyes. and comes with a P3 wide color gamut display.

In addition, authentication will be Touch ID on the top button as usual. And most importantly, the screen of the iPad Air 5 does not have ProMotion 120Hz, which ProMotion 120Hz screen will only be on the iPad Pro model.
Quick connect
The iPad Air 5 has a fast wireless connection with Wi-Fi 6 support, making it seamless to download files quickly or watch shows with friends using SharePlay. Comes with Bluetooth 5.0 connectivity, and in cellular models, it also supports 5G.

USB-C 3.1 connector port
iPad Air 5 has a USB-C 3.1 connector that is 2x faster than the previous generation. Data transfer speeds of up to 10 Gbps and support for sending images to additional screens in resolutions up to 6K.
Support a variety of accessories
iPad Air 5 is compatible with a wide range of accessories and devices including the 2nd generation Apple Pencil, Magic Keyboard, and Smart Keyboard Folio.
